If you get a pair of Shimano clipless pedals, they'll come packaged with a set of cleats for your footwear. For off-road and also metropolitan SPD pedals, the cleats are constructed from metal as well as affixed to the soles of your shoes with 2 bolts, whereas the road-specific SPD-SL plastic cleats are affixed with 3 bolts (you can review our explainer on SPD vs SPD-SL pedals).

Look at the specs on Shimano's website and also it states the SM-SH56 as an optional cleat. Shimano likewise has a series of 'Explorer' pedals, which include the brand name's 'Light Action' release system. Many of these come packaged with the SM-SH56 cleats, with SM-SH51 cleats as a choice. What's the distinction in between Shimano SH-SH56 as well as SM-SH51 cleats, and why might you choose one over the various other? Allow us explain.

They're interchangeable between left and also right footwear. The only clue regarding which kind of cleat you have is the SH51 cleats are black, whereas the SH56 cleats are silver-coloured, plus there's an M embossed on the rear-facing tab of the SH56. You can acquire Shimano SPD-compatible cleats from other brands, too.

The sort of cleat is marked on the front of the Look cleats' bottoms - Cleats Report. Shimano's SH51 cleats are black, whereas the SH56 cleats are silver. The distinction between SH51 cleats and SH56 cleats is the variety of instructions in which you can launch the cleat from the pedal. SH51 cleats have a solitary direction of launch; that's to claim you can just disengage from the pedal by pressing your heel out in a level plane about the pedal, or by pressing it in.

There's no right or wrong solution to which kind of cleats to choose. Which cleats work best for you depends on the sort of riding you do as well as also how certain you are riding with clipless pedals.

The understanding curve is a whole lot less high than with the road-going SPD-SL pedal system. If you're riding on even more technological surface, specifically off-road, having multiple release angles might be a disadvantage, since you're far more most likely to come unclipped when you don't wish to. That's why Shimano's off-road pedal range includes SH51 cleats instead than SH56.

Although SH56 cleats might be helpful for a novice bothered with having problems unclipping, it's likely that standing firm with SH51 cleats, and also reducing the launch stress on the pedal, will assist as much as the multi-directional release - Cleats Report. Reducing pedal-release tension is basic, by turning the hex nut on the release system behind the pedal anticlockwise.

When you have the cleats bolted to your SPD biking footwear as well as the clipless pedals on your bicycle (we're pleased to help), you simply step on the pedals to click your feet safely in position (most systems make a "click" when you're secured). When engaged, your feet are connected to the pedals for maximum efficiency.

To get out, you swing your feet heels first to the outside as if you're obtaining ready to put your feet down, as well as the pedals release. One of the more most vital point is practicing before striking the road or path. This is especially vital if you started with toe clips and also straps, which call for a different foot motion to get your feet out.

Educate your feet this activity while dominating the bike. You're simply mosting likely to exercise getting your feet in and also out, not remain on the seat or flight anywhere. If you're bothered with tipping over, practice on a yard or soft surface. Also much better, if you have an interior fitness instructor, mount your bike on it as well as practice in position.
